The Opportunity:

This is a Senior post which will see you take responsibility for concurrently delivering multiple, large new build Highways schemes in the Eastern region for a major client. You will act as a leading figurehead on some of the most exciting Highway’s projects in the UK and can expect to take ownership of the delivery and quality of work whilst regularly liaising with Engineering teams to ensure the harmonious execution of works.

Most of these schemes are at early stages so this position will provide you with the satisfaction of taking projects full cycle and seeing them through until the end.

What is expected of you as Project Manager?

  • Communication is key in this position as you can expect to see yourself engaging with the Designers, stakeholders, Construction teams, Commercial teams, Supply Chain partners, Client, and all involved across the board to ensure works are executed at a subliminal level to Budget, Programme and Scope.
  • You will be acting as a key figurehead in this role, leading the way on all things Health & Safety whilst promoting the project and company through external awards, professional lectures, trade press articles and site visit.
  • You will be taking responsibility of the planning and preparation of the scheme’s delivery throughout the project lifecycle.
  • Manage, monitor and review direct reports and team performances, providing encouragement and discipline as and when required.

Reward and renumeration:

This role comes with a fantastic basic salary circa £60,000 - £65,000 per annum, on top of your basic salary you can have the choice of a Grade 4 company car or a car allowance. Along with a 5% matched pension, 28 days holiday + bank holidays, health insurance, life assurance and two charity leave days. About You:

Due to the nature of the schemes, it is a given that you’ll have an impressive background working on large scale, new build civil engineering projects – Ideally valued above £40 million. It is essential that you’re a technically qualified, established Project Manager or Senior Project manager with experience in a main contractor environment working throughout the entire project lifecycle.

With this role being positioned in the Highways division, it would certainly be of benefit that you have a background in this industry, however, those with substantial experience on large projects in Civil engineering will also be considered. This could mean you’ve delivered major projects in either Highways, Rail, or Water.
